A typical day for a Private Duty Nurse includes:
  • Completing assessments.
  • Auditing and managing medical charts.
  • Managing medications for the individuals.
  • Giving appropriate medical/nursing directions by responding to all calls, emails, and messages.
  • Communicating with community doctors/pharmacists.
  • Responding to all calls, emails and message to give appropriate medical/nursing directions.
  • Assisting with other duties as needed and as assigned by the Branch Manager.
  • Private Duty Nursing in the home setting.

In order to be eligible for this role, you should have:
  • A current RN or LPN license
  • Preferred experience with private duty nursing, ideally with infants or pediatrics
